cpu雙核什么意思
cpu雙核什么意思
cpu雙核什么意思呢,下面是學習啦小編帶來的關于cpu雙核什么意思的內容,歡迎閱讀!
cpu雙核什么意思:
雙核簡單來說就是2個核心,核心(core)又稱為內核,是CPU最重要的組成部分。CPU中心那塊隆起的芯片就是核心,是由單晶硅以一定的生產工藝制造出來的,CPU所有的計算、接受/存儲命令、處理數據都由核心執(zhí)行。各種CPU核心都具有固定的邏輯結構,一級緩存、二級緩存、執(zhí)行單元、指令級單元和總線接口等邏輯單元都會有科學的布局。
從雙核技術本身來看,到底什么是雙內核?毫無疑問雙內核應該具備兩個物理上的運算內核,而這兩個內核的設計應用方式卻大有文章可作。據現有的資料顯示,AMDOpteron處理器從一開始設計時就考慮到了添加第二個內核,兩個CPU內核使用相同的系統(tǒng)請求接口SRI、HyperTransport技術和內存控制器,兼容90納米單內核處理器所使用的940引腳接口。
而英特爾的雙核心卻僅僅是使用兩個完整的CPU封裝在一起,連接到同一個前端總線上??梢哉f,AMD的解決方案是真正的"雙核",而英特爾的解決方案則是"雙芯"。
可以設想,這樣的兩個核心必然會產生總線爭搶,影響性能。不僅如此,還對于未來更多核心的集成埋下了隱患,因為會加劇處理器爭用前端總線帶寬,成為提升系統(tǒng)性能的瓶頸,而這是由架構決定的。因此可以說,AMD的技術架構為實現雙核和多核奠定了堅實的基礎。
AMD直連架構(也就是通過超傳輸技術讓CPU內核直接跟外部I/O相連,不通過前端總線)和集成內存控制器技術,使得每個內核都有自己的高速緩存可資遣用,都有自己的專用車道直通I/O,沒有資源爭搶的問題,實現雙核和多核更容易。而Intel是多個核心共享二級緩存、共同使用前端總線的,當內核增多,核心的處理能力增強時,肯定要遇到堵的問題。
為什么用雙核處理器:
出于技術挑戰(zhàn),雙核被強加給產業(yè),而產業(yè)并沒有事先做好準備。英特爾和AMD采用這項技術的真正原因,不是因為雙核是一種突然出現的一種優(yōu)秀創(chuàng)意。實際上,芯片廠商本可以非常滿足地不斷推出速度越來越快的單核處理器。但是,這種做法是不可行的,因為隨著時鐘速度超過3GHz,單核處理器開始消耗過多的功率。
確實,英特爾在2005年取消了計劃中的4.0GHz "Tejas"處理器,因為該芯片的功耗可能超過100W。隨著功耗的上升,超快單核芯片的冷卻代價也越來越高,它要求采用更大的散熱器和更有力的風扇,以保持其工作溫度。利用雙核方案,既可以繼續(xù)改善處理器性能,又可以暫時避開功耗和散熱難題。
AMD商業(yè)解決方案主管Margaret Lewis表示:"這是因為,作為處理器廠商,這是我們能夠在一定的功耗范圍內提高性能的唯一途徑。" 此外,有些人認為雙核并不是萬能藥。正如2005年6月發(fā)表的文章《深入了解雙核》所言:"從我們的立場來看,雙核并不是新東西;它只是改頭換面的老產品(對稱多重處理)……在單一處理器基礎上建立的雙處理器系統(tǒng)所面臨的同樣的性能問題仍然存在。" 但是,這作為一種簡單的解釋,基本上足夠了。Lewis補充道:"物理定律沒有改變;我們只是想出了如何進一步改進的方法。"